Output d0676e52f84d0775dcea4eaa2143ddf0732c436cb0ee5ab0a2bfb3adeb6873fc:0

value
802180
script pubkey
OP_0 OP_PUSHBYTES_20 dbbc8655d0c0b518a883fb50839a63e62c4cf7e4
address
bc1qmw7gv4wscz6332yrldgg8xnruckyealytmemxy
transaction
d0676e52f84d0775dcea4eaa2143ddf0732c436cb0ee5ab0a2bfb3adeb6873fc
confirmations
185294
spent
true